Spectrum Blue Summary

Bruce Halberstrom, a young, upwardly mobile executive, is severely debilitated after being struck down by a hereditary aneurysm. While undergoing a lengthy period of convalescence at an institute in White Plains New York, he receives a visit from his mother-a recovering alcoholic-who has been absent from his life for twenty years. She brings a mysterious letter written many years before by a man called Rafael who accompanied Halberstrom's father into a remote region of the mountains of Chiapas in southern Mexico.

The letter foretells the onset of Halberstrom's stroke, and subtly suggests the possibility there is purpose behind the event that has profoundly changed the course of Halberstrom's life. To discover the hidden truths surrounding the events leading to his father's death many years before when in the company of the letter writer, Halberstrom must make a difficult journey to the settlement where Rafael still lives with his family.

Reaching a level of physical strength that will barely see him through the ordeal to follow, Halberstrom reaches his destination, to find himself in the company of Rafael and his beautiful granddaughter Llana. The three of them then set out on a trek into the mountains that will bring experiences that will stretch Halberstrom's preconceived ideas of the physical world to their limit.
